The article reports on a jailbreak in New Orleans where 10 prisoners escaped. A maintenance worker, Sterling Williams, was arrested for allegedly aiding the escape. Prosecutors claimed that Williams turned off the water to a toilet, allowing inmates to cut the pipe and create an escape route. However, Williams' lawyer asserted that Williams was merely responding to a clogged toilet, not part of a planned escape. The man will face charges related to the incident.
